Pixel Tribe's Goddess Order: A Deep Dive into Pixel Art and Gameplay

This email interview with Ilsun (Art Director) and Terron J. (Contents Director) from Pixel Tribe offers a fascinating look behind the scenes of their upcoming Kakao Games title, Goddess Order. We explore their pixel art techniques, world-building process, and innovative combat design.

Pixel Perfection: Crafting the Characters

Ilsun explains that the game's high-quality pixel art aims for a console-like feel, emphasizing storytelling. Character design draws inspiration from a wide range of games and stories, with the focus on nuanced expression through pixel arrangement rather than direct imitation. The initial characters, Lisbeth, Violet, and Jan, emerged from Ilsun's solo work and were collaboratively refined through discussions with colleagues, shaping the overall art style. This collaborative approach continues, with scenario writers and combat designers contributing to character concepts which are then brought to life by the art team.

World-Building from the Ground Up

Terron J. reveals that Goddess Order's world-building is intrinsically linked to its characters. The initial trio, Lisbeth, Violet, and Jan, formed the foundation for the game's narrative and gameplay. The characters' inherent personalities, motivations, and stories drove the world-building process, creating a rich and immersive setting. The emphasis on manual controls in combat stemmed from the team's desire to showcase the characters' strength and agency within the game's narrative.

Dynamic Combat: Design and Animation

Goddess Order's combat system features three-character turn-based battles with link skills promoting synergy. Terron J. details the design process, highlighting the importance of defining unique roles for each character to ensure strategic depth. Ilsun adds that the art team strives for visually impactful combat, using three-dimensional movement principles within the 2D pixel art to create dynamic battles. The team even uses real-world weapons to study movement for added realism. Technical optimization is crucial, ensuring a smooth and immersive experience on mobile devices, even on lower-spec hardware.

The Future of Goddess Order

Ilsun outlines future plans for Goddess Order, including expanding the narrative with chapter scenarios and character origin stories. The team also intends to introduce additional activities, such as quests and treasure hunts, and advanced content to challenge players' skills. Continuous updates and community feedback will play a key role in shaping the game's future.
